<p>Even  today,  Texas  Instruments  remains  the  indispensable  manufacturer  of  this  technology.    Many  dissimilar  makers  license  the  engineering science  from  Texas  Instruments,  and  build  their  productions  around  the  TI  chipset.    In  addition  to  it is  use  in  televisions  and  projectors,  DLP  engineering  is  employed  in  a  number  of  specialized  apps  such  as  lithography  and  imaging.</p>
<p>DLP  engineering science  is different  from  other  video  engineering  in  that  it  utilizes  a  little  digital  micromirror  device  (DMD)  to  tilt  more  than  1.3  million  of  these  tiny  mirrors,  each  of  them  littler  than  the  width  of  a  humane  hair  either  toward  or  away  from  the  light  source  contained  within  the  DLP  device.    This  routine  produces  the  dark  and  light  pixels  which  appear  on  the  projection  screen.</p>
<p>The  light  is  then  filtered  through  a  color  wheel  rotating  at  120  times  per  second,  to  create  a  engineering  that  is  capable  of  fabricating  numerous  1024  dissimilar  shades  of  gray.    It  is  this  gradation  of  color  that  in truth  makes  DLP  technology  stand  out,  and  these  gradations  of  color  are  achieved  using  color  filters  which  are  backlit  using  just  the  right  intensity  of  pure  white  light.</p>
<p>There  are  four  major  parts  to  the  DLP  system:</p>
<p>*The  DMD  chip,  which  controls  the  mirrors</p>
<p>*The  color  wheel</p>
<p>*The  light  source  and</p>
<p>*The  optics</p>
<p>In  order  to  give rise to  the  picture,  the  light  from  the  lamp  passes  through  the  color  wheel  filter  and  into  the  DMD  chip,  which  then  switches  it is  mirrors  on  or  off  according  to  the  color  which  is  reflecting  off  of  them.</p>
<p>This  digital  light  processing,  or  DLP,  engineering science  is  quickly  getting  a  major  player  in  the  world  of  the  rear  projection  TV,  and  more  than  two  million  of  these  TVs  have  been  sold.    More  than  50  makers  trade  at  least  one  model  of  DLP  based  television,  and  as  of  2004  the  DLP  TV  had  achieved  a  10%  market  share.    In  addition,  little  standalone  units,  known  in  the  business  as  front  projectors,  have  become  usual  items  both  in  the  world  of  business  demonstrations  and  in  the  world  of  home  theater.</p>

<p>185 of 193 people found the following review helpful.<br /><img height="11" width="56" style="margin-left:0px;margin-right:10px" class="custReviewStars" src="http://images.amazon.com/images/G/01/associates/network/star40_tpng.png" alt="4">Excellet TV overall, Oustanding when viewed from front and center<br /><span>By SGatefield<br />As of this writing (Sept. 25, 2011), I&#8217;ve had the Sony XBR-55HX929 for just over two months, so I thought it was about time I shared my impressions of it. Nothing I have to say differs significantly from what other (positive) reviews have said, but I thought I&#8217;d contribute to the collective wisdom.</p>
<p>Let me start off with a bit of context: I have had, at least briefly, five HDTVs since March 2011: a 62&#8243; Mitsubishi WD-62525 (a rear projection TV with 720p native resolution), a Panasonic TC-P55ST30 (plasma), a Samsung PN59D6500 (also a plasma), a Samsung UN55D6900 (an LED edge-lit LCD), and the Sony XBR-55HX929 (LED backlit LCD with local dimming). The Mitsubishi died in late March and I have been searching for a replacement. As you can see, I&#8217;ve tried out just about the full array of TV technologies. My search has ended with the Sony XBR-55HX929, and I am very happy with it. I will compare the Sony with some of the other sets I&#8217;ve had below.</p>
<p>There are a number of concerns that owners or prospective owners of the Sony have had, so let me address those. First, the build date. I ordered my set from Amazon.com on July 9, it shipped on the 13th and was delivered the 20th. It was assembled in Mexico in March 2011.</p>
<p>The dreaded &#8220;crease&#8221;: Yes, mine has the crease (a slightly darker &#8220;line&#8221; that appears along the sides of the image on many of these Sonys, usually on the left and right, but sometimes along the top and bottom edges, about an inch in from the bezel). I have fairly faint creasing on both the left and right sides. It seems a bit darker towards the bottom of the screen.</p>
<p>However: I agree with many owners and contributors to discussion forums that under normal viewing circumstances&#8211;when you are watching &#8220;real content&#8221; rather putting up a uniform (or nearly uniform) field of color for inspection purposes&#8211;I never notice it. My wife has never noticed it, nor has anyone who has come over to see the set. I can see it on the PS3&#8242;s home screen, but that hardly bothers me. It surprises me a bit that I say this, since I am quite picky and minor imperfections often irritate me to no end (this is one reason I&#8217;ve gone through all the sets mentioned above!). If I could see it when I viewed typical content, I&#8217;d return the set. But I don&#8217;t. As it is now, I wouldn&#8217;t dream of returning the set.</p>
<p>So, my view is that the &#8220;crease&#8221; issue should not deter you from getting the Sony XBR-HX929. If you don&#8217;t need a new set right away, by all means wait a couple of months and perhaps there will be a reliable stream of crease-free sets (though a recent comment from Sony UK has me somewhat doubtful). If you must buy now, I don&#8217;t think the crease should scare you away from this set. (Well&#8230; I&#8217;m a bit torn about this actually: Despite what Sony UK has recently said, the crease is probably a manufacturing defect, and a top-of-the-line item shouldn&#8217;t have manufacturing defects. So, I can sympathize with those who do not want to give Sony money for releasing a very expensive product with such a defect.)</p>
<p>Like some others, I am planning to put a call it to Sony to report the crease. The more they hear about it, the more likely they are to do something. Also, if there is a recall, or an offer to replace sets with the crease, etc., I would certainly be interested in taking Sony up on that.</p>
<p>Picture quality: I&#8217;m using David Katzmaier&#8217;s (from CNET) recommended settings. Viewed from straight on, front and center, at eye level, the picture is outstanding (4.5 or 5 out of 5 stars). The blacks are truly black&#8211;deep, inky, and virtually indistinguishable from the bezel, especially when you view from a high-quality source like a Blu-ray. It is the only TV of those I&#8217;ve owned with blacks as deep as the Panasonic plasma&#8217;s. These deep blacks make for excellent contrast, which (along with strong shadow detail and good gamma) gives the image natural depth and that &#8220;pop&#8221; that impresses viewers so much.</p>
<p>Colors are both rich and realistic. Shadow detail is excellent. Blu-ray movies I&#8217;ve watched on this set so far include Toy Story 3, Baraka, Master and Commander, Harry Potter and the Prisoner of Azkaban, and Rango. All looked absolutely fantastic (though I give the overall nod to Toy Story 3). Best in-home theater experiences I&#8217;ve ever had. I am consistently &#8220;wow-ed&#8221; by the picture on this set.</p>
<p>Comparison with the Samsung UN55D6900 LCD. The colors on the Samsung were excellent (once I got the user-adjustable settings right&#8211;which is relatively easy on the Samsung thanks to its RGB-only mode: one of the things I like better about Samsung than the Sony). Still, the Sony&#8217;s are at least as good (I didn&#8217;t do a side-by-side, simultaneous comparison, so it is difficult to say for sure which was better). However, there is one area in which the Sony clearly and, in my view, crucially bests the Samsung. The Samsung is an edge-lit LED-LCD (as are all of the upper end Samsung LCDs), which means that the LEDs that provide the light for the TV&#8217;s picture shine in from the edges of the set&#8211;parallel to the surface of the screen/LCD. Like many owners of Samsung&#8217;s LCDs (see user forums), I was really bothered by the flashlighting (when light from the LEDs bleeds into a corner of the image), clouding (areas of the screen that appear lighter than they should) and generally uneven dark-scene performance exhibited by this set. The Sony&#8217;s full-array LED backlighting (in which the light producing LEDs are arranged behind the screen, shining light perpendicular to the surface of, or out through, the LCD screen) with local dimming is superior in this regard, hands down. Even my wife agrees. (Though she didn&#8217;t think the improvement was worth the heftier price tag. Obviously I disagreed!) Using the PLUGE pattern on the DVE calibration disc, I could never get the 2%-above-black bars on either side of the central gray-scale bar to be equally visible on the Samsung&#8211;when the one to the left of the center gray scale was just visible, the one on the right wouldn&#8217;t be. To improve this, I had to crank up the brightness, which improved shadow detail, but (obviously) hurt black levels. No such problem on the Sony. Both +2% bars are equally visible while the blacks stay black and shadow detail is preserved.</p>
<p>Viewing angles: A weakness, and one of the reasons I don&#8217;t give the set a 5-star rating. The Sony cannot compete with the Panasonic or Samsung plasmas on this aspect of picture quality. Still, the viewing angles are not as bad as I feared from reading reviews and some other user comments. The picture washes out worst as you move away from front-and-center when the material is dark, but from my usual viewing distance of about 10 feet, I can sit on either side of my couch (a three-cushion, 6.5ft couch) and notice very little change in the picture. I would say that viewing angles are comparable to the Samsung LCD (though I didn&#8217;t do extensive tests on this&#8211;I was primarily concerned with screen uniformity when comparing these). For something like sports on ESPN, and most cable/ local broadcasts, I can walk from one side of the room to the other without any bothersome loss of picture quality.</p>
<p>Blooming (a &#8220;halo&#8221; of light that shouldn&#8217;t be there surrounding a bright object on a dark background): It happens, but again, not as bad as I feared. (It is worth noting that some blooming is virtually unavoidable on LED backlit LCD televisions.) With actual viewing material (blu-rays, dvd movies), viewed from front center, I observe infrequent blooming. Blooming is really only apparent on end credits, and images like PS3 pause and quit screens, but that hardly matters to me.</p>
<p>Now, off-angle blooming is a different story. Not only does the screen wash out if you view from too far off-center, blooming becomes significant. Bad enough that it is another reason I don&#8217;t give the set 5 stars. The moral: watch from front and center when you want that ultimate home theater experience!</p>
<p>The edge-lit Samsung LCD didn&#8217;t exhibit blooming to the same degree, even off angle&#8211;but I&#8217;ll take the off angle and credit-screen blooming over flashlighting and clouding problems. (They are related problems, actually: all result when light from the LEDs shows up where it shouldn&#8217;t.)</p>
<p>Plasmas don&#8217;t (or shouldn&#8217;t) exhibit blooming, so again, the clear advantage goes to the Samsung and Panasonic plasmas on this aspect of picture quality.</p>
<p>Dirty Screen Effect (uneven picture uniformity during pans that makes it look like there is something on the screen&#8211;sort of like a thin film of dirt): Yes, I notice it occasionally, but mainly on standard definition and pseudo-HD sources like Netflix streaming. I didn&#8217;t notice it on any of the blu-ray movies I watched (see above).</p>
<p>Video games/response time: My test material is Zen Pinball on the PS3. Good response times are important for this game (though not as much as for fighting games), since you want the &#8220;paddles&#8221; to move the instant you hit the shoulder buttons. Response time is good. Significantly better than on the Samsung LCD. I would say it is comparable or perhaps just slightly worse than the Panasonic plasma, though this is a memory-based judgment of which I am not terribly confident, so take it for what it is worth. Also: none of these sets were on Game Mode. I have local dimming set to Standard on the Sony. Response times are improved with local dimming set to Off and when the set is put in Game Mode. Nevertheless, I&#8217;m perfectly happy with the response times, even with local dimming On (the picture is better this way).</p>
<p>Appearance: I think this is an awesome-looking set. The monolithic design, with the single sheet of glass from edge to edge is really cool. It is better looking than either plasma (the Panasonic has the most boring design), no question. It&#8217;s a tough call between the Sony and the Samsung LCD. I thought the Samsung was also very good looking. It&#8217;s a toss up, and I could see someone going either way. The Samsung is a bit flashier, a bit sexier, with the super-thin bezel and clear strip of plastic around the edge, but the Sony has a more refined, sophisticated look to it. I do wish you could turn off the green &#8220;on&#8221; light though&#8230; I don&#8217;t need to be told that the set is on when there is an image on the screen!</p>
<p>Reflectiveness: This was a pleasant surprise. CNET&#8217;s review had me concerned that it would be very reflective, but it isn&#8217;t. It is significantly less reflective than the Samsung LCD. It is similar to the Panasonic plasma. Can you see reflections? Yes, absolutely.  But they are dull, muted and rather faint, despite the fact that I have two fairly large windows on the south-facing side of my 12&#8242;x10&#8242; living room (perpendicular to the direction the TV faces).</p>
<p>Table-top stand: Yes, the TV wobbles when it is on the stand and you swivel the TV. I think any &#8220;single-stalk&#8221; swivel stand, as is also used by Samsung, will allow the TV to wobble. But unlike some others, I have no significant &#8220;tilting&#8221; or &#8220;listing&#8221; of the TV on the stand. Use a level when you put the stand together, check it when you put the TV on the stand, and only tighten the screws when you have it level (it can help to have another person hold the TV in the level position. You should be able to get it very level this way. The stand is much better than the Samsung&#8217;s stand (I did have issues with the Samsungs, both the LCD and the plasma, being level) and it is made of tougher material. The Panasonic plasma was the sturdiest of the bunch, by far (but the Panasonic&#8217;s stand was not a swivel stand, so&#8230;).</p>
<p>Remote: I think the Sony remote is good. A little bulky, but the buttons are nicely arranged and on the whole it is very functional. The concave top really does guide your thumb naturally to the all-important central &#8220;enter&#8221; button. I like the dedicated Netflix button too&#8211;there&#8217;s no easier way to watch Netflix: just two button pushes (&#8220;TV On&#8221; then &#8220;Netflix&#8221;)!</p>
<p>3D: I haven&#8217;t used 3D on this TV yet, so I cannot comment. Reviews such as CNET&#8217;s suggest that 3D is not this set&#8217;s strong suit, and user forums don&#8217;t do much to refute this. I do think it is ridiculous that Sony doesn&#8217;t include a pair of 3D glasses, especially given the price of this TV. Which brings me to&#8230;</p>
<p>Price: Prices have come down lately, and with the LG LW9800 and the Sharp Elite hitting the streets, it is no longer the most expensive consumer television in its category. But none of this changes the fact that this is a really expensive television. It is the most expensive I&#8217;ve had, and I never intended to spend this much. The Panasonic and Samsung plasmas offer much better value, in my opinion, while the uniformity issues with the Samsung LCD keep it from being a good value.</p>
<p>Other: Some folks have complained about the organization/ ease of use of the menu systems, but I actually find the menus pretty sensible (of course, I&#8217;m used to the basic set up since I have a PS3, so&#8230;). Internet content is solid. Unlike some others, I have been able to use the browser&#8211;but it is quite slow and I prefer to do my browsing on a computer or an iPad anyway. It would be nice if Sony added the vTuner internet radio, as Samsung did, but this is a very minor complaint. Samsung offers the best suite of Internet options, in my opinion. But more importantly (for me), the Sony handles streaming video (e.g., Netflix) better than the Samsung LCD did. Streaming video often had significant &#8220;stutter&#8221; on the Samsung. To get rid of it I had to use motion smoothing, which resulted in the dreaded &#8220;soap opera effect&#8221;, which I hate. True, I was able to tweak the settings to get it to look right, but the constant tweaking I was doing on the Samsung LCD was itself a problem. The Sony handles Internet content well in my preferred settings (and sometimes automatically shifts to a different setting, which also works well, then automatically returns to my custom setting when, for instance, I pop in a blu-ray).</p>
<p>I have been very happy with how well the Sony works with my AV receiver&#8211;a Pioneer VSX-1021-K. The HDMI ARC works flawlessly (it was hit-or-miss with the Samsung LCD), and the Sony automatically turns the AVR on when I turn it on (doesn&#8217;t automatically turn it off though), which is convenient. I never had to do anything to get it to do that (other than connect the two devices via their ARC-capable HDMI ports).</p>
<p>I think that about covers it. Overall, the Sony XBR-55HX929 is an excellent TV. I initially wanted a plasma, but unfortunately I see &#8220;phosphor trails&#8221; when I watch plasmas (yellow after images/ flashes when I move my eyes or when a light object moves across a dark background) and I&#8217;m sensitive to the 60Hz refresh rate that Panasonic plasmas use, so no plasma for me. I&#8217;m happy to have found an LCD with a comparable, and in some ways better, picture&#8211;as long as you watch from front and center!</p>
<p>Is this TV for you? It depends. First, you need to decide whether you want to get an LCD or a plasma. Many plasmas provide comparable or better overall picture quality for much less money. The Panasonic TC-P55ST30, for instance, is nearly as good as this Sony on black levels and color, while being clearly superior with respect to blooming and viewing angles, yet costs about half the price. But if you have a very bright room, or don&#8217;t want to take reasonable precautions to avoid plasma burn in, or insist on the most energy efficient devices, then an LCD is probably the way to go. In that case, if you&#8217;ve got the money, insist on top-notch picture quality, and you (and maybe one other person) can typically watch TV from front and center, then you will be very happy with the Sony XBR-55HX929.</p>

<p><u>How  100Hz  in the first place  worked</u></p>
<p>A  standard  PAL  television  will  refresh  the  picture  50  times  per  second  or  at  a  frequency  of  50Hz.  The  Frames  Per  Second  (FPS)  are  the  amount  of  frames  necessitated  to  fabricate  the  illusion  of  motion.  Our  eyes  are  often times  conscious  of  this  frequency  depending  on  the  speed  of  the  image,  the  intensity  of  darkness,  and  the  intensity  of  luminance  accordingly  you  will  on  occasion  detect  the  picture  flicker  on  a  50Hz  Television.  Moreover  the  more prominent  the  screen  is  the  more  evident  the  flicker  is.</p>
<p>At  100  FPS  (100Hz)  TV  operates  at  twice  the  Frames  Per  Second  by  creating  a  duplicate  of  each  frame  and  inserting  it  after  the  former  one.  On  a  50  FPS  (50Hz)  Cathode  Ray  Television  (CRT)  because  the  picture  is  devised  by  an  charged  particle  scan  there  is  a  visible  flicker  that  may  be  seen  by  the  humane  eye.  As  a  result  of  doubling  the  scan  frequency  to  100FPS  and  inserting  a  copy  frame  this  problem  is  not  apparent  as  far  as  the  humane  eye  is  concerned.  The  result  of  this  is  to  appreciably  reduce  the  flicker.</p>
<p><u>The  gain  of  100Hz  on  Plasma  and  LCD  TV&#8217;s</u></p>
<p>Plasma  and  LCD  televisions  don&#8217;t  have  flickering  because  they  don&#8217;t  generate  the  picture  with  an  electron  scan.  However  LCD  and  Plasma  TVs  still  gain  from  100  Herts  because  modern  digital  circuitry  brings about  an  further  frame  or  middle  image.  The  Television  does  this  by  creating  an  further  frame  by  means  of  elaborated  interpolation,  as  well  as  motion  compensation  calculations  to  calculate  what  the  addition  fields  and  frames  look  like,  rather  of  inserting  a  copy  frame.  (e.g.  the  initial  and  second  frames  are  different).</p>
<p>Nevertheless  even  at  100Hz  the  picture  still  does  not  give rise to  a  wholly  smooth  picture  in particular  with  fast  motion  images.  Several  television  manufactures  undertake  to  reduce  this  further  by  using  digital  picture  processing.  Typically  there  is  still  a  little  blurring  on  quick  moving  images  even though  the  vantages  are  clearer  and  better-defined  surfaces,  smoother  movement,  and  sharper  pictures  than  is  possible  from  50  Frames  Per  Second  LCD  TVs  and  PlasmaTVs.</p>
<p>For  example  if  a  football  moves  ten  pixels  from  left  to  right  amid  frames  one,  two  and  three,  the  100Hz  television  will  digitally  make  two  added  frames  amid  one  and  two,  along  with  two  and  three,  in  which  the  ball  will  move  five  pixels.  This  results  in  five  frames  in  which  the  football  moves  a  total  of  ten  pixels  i.e.  the  initial  frames  one,  two  and  three  plus  the  digitally  developed  frames  inserted  among  one  and  two,  and  in  amid  two  and  three.  The  effect  of  this  is  that  the  eye  sees  an  effigy  that  moves  more  with no problems or difficulties  than  previously.</p>
<p>The  vantage  is  that  100Hz  televisions  have  a  clear  gain  of  ending  the  majority  ghosting  effects  now  and  then  seen  in  LCD  TVs.  The  ghosting  effect  caused  by  the  subsequent  effigy  being  displayed  before  the  preceding  one  has  faded  away.</p>
<p>Most  top  manufacturers  have  got  100Hz  Plasma  and  LCD  televisions  including  JVC,  Panasonic,  Toshiba,  Samsung,  LG,  Sony,  Philips,Hitachi  and  Pioneer.</p>
<p><u>Further  vantages  with  200Hz</u></p>
<p>A  range  of  200  hertz  televisions  have  been  devised  by  Sony  which  digitally  inserts  three  further and added  frames  in  amongst  the  introductory  50Hz  frames.  Thus  speedily  moving  scenes  are  seen  with  a  smoother,  more  liquid  and  sharper  picture  than  50Hz  or  even  100  hertz  televisions.</p>
<p><u>Benefits  for  people  who  have  photosensitive  epilepsy</u></p>
<p>Research  has  shown  that  100Hz  TV&#8217;s  may  aid  in  preventing  seizures  in  persons  who  suffer  with  photosensitive  epilepsies  when  looking at  television  or  playing  computer  games.</p>

<p>11 of 12 people found the following review helpful.<br /><img height="11" width="56" style="margin-left:0px;margin-right:10px" class="custReviewStars" src="http://images.amazon.com/images/G/01/associates/network/star50_tpng.png" alt="5">Squaretrade is as good as their word! (don&#8217;t throw away your receipt)<br /><span>By Senor Zoidbergo<br />I purchased a 42&#8243; flat screen tv a few years ago, and was naturally concerned about what to do after the 1 year manufacturer&#8217;s warranty had expired. The store offered its own extended warranty program, but I was hesitant about putting down hundreds of dollars for a 3 year extended warranty. Surely there was something more economical with the same, or better service?</p>
<p>I heard, via word of mouth, of a third-party alternative called Squaretrade. Intrigued, I checked reseller ratings, and was very shocked to see a lifetime rating of 9.7. I read many of the reviews, and they all consistently praised ST&#8217;s dedication to fulfilling its warranty promises. Of the few that were not pleased with ST service (and some of them were the customer&#8217;s fault), I was impressed by the follow-up messages left by ST&#8217;s representatives to resolve the situation.</p>
<p>Convinced, I ended up purchasing a 3 year warranty through Squaretrade, for just ~$40. ST runs monthly %-off discounts, so you can always get a very good bargain. To clarify, if I remember correctly, the 3 year warranty is really a 2 year warranty, since the first year overlaps with the first year of the manufacturer&#8217;s warranty. However, you should read the fine print to double check.</p>
<p>Talk about knocking on wood. My TV broke recently, and so I submitted my claim form to ST, which primarily comprised faxing a copy of my receipt to them (don&#8217;t throw it away!), and describing my problem. I was expecting a reply a few months later, but Squaretrade promises resolution in less than week. I was shocked to find in my email inbox, a message from ST indicating that since it was cost prohibitive to ship my TV back to them for repairs, they would instead be refunding my original purchase price in its entirety, through PayPal. Sure enough, the money was sent the next day.</p>
<p>This is legendary service, the kind consumers dream about. You can buy a ST warranty with complete confidence, and be assured of their guarantees. Regarding TVs, they will not cover certain issues, e.g. burn-in on a plasma, and lamp replacements on DLPs. Again, check the fine print (don&#8217;t worry, there&#8217;s not too much to read).</p>
<p>I&#8217;m going to be buying all my warranties through ST in the future, recommending them to my friends and families, and making sure my children, and my children&#8217;s children buy Squaretrade warranties. I wholeheartedly recommend them (and no, I&#8217;m not getting paid by ST to write this review).</p>
